W.P. Griffin Inc. is a family owned and operated farming business located in Elmsdale, in the western part of Prince Edward Island. PEI, the smallest province of Canada, is sometimes called Spud Island, with 94,800 acres of potatoes harvested in 2006.

John Griffin, President of W.P. Griffin Inc., acts as General Manager in charge of administration and oversees the farming and packaging operations. Peter Griffin is the Vice-President and Operations Manager in charge of the packaging warehouse, and the farming and cattle operations.

W.P. Griffin Inc. presently farms 1,100 acres of potatoes, 950 acres of grain, 650 acres of hay and has 350 beef cattle in a finishing feed lot. The company is divided into three divisions: Farming Operation, Packaging Warehouse and Cattle Operation. For more information about our operations, please visit A Farming Tradition.

Wilfred P. Griffin, founder of W.P. Griffin Inc., started working in the potato industry in 1947 at the age of 19. He started as business manager and by 1958, he was the sole proprietor and incorporated in 1969.

Wilfred Patrick Griffin was born May 24, 1928 to Thomas and Mary Griffin in Brocton, Prince Edward Island. He graduated St. Dunstan's in 1946. He worked as a teacher but in 1947 became involved in the potato industry at the age of 19. He started as a business manager for Ronald McKenna and by 1958 became sole proprietor. In 1969 he incorporated his business to W. P. Griffin Incorporated as it is known today.

Wilfred married Mary Ellen (Marie) Gaudet on Nov. 10, 1962. Marie worked in the office from 1967 to 1997. Marie worked side-by-side with Wilfred as the business grew from 100 acres to a 1000 acres of potatoes per year. Together they raised a family of four children, Barbara, Peter, John and Eleanor.

Their sons John and Peter joined them in family business as they expanded their farming business to included a modern packing facility capable of packaging washed or unwashed potatoes in a wide variety of packages.
